A New Method for Oxidation of Various Alcohols to the Corresponding Carbonyl Compounds by Using<i>N</i>-<i>t</i>-Butylbenzenesulfinimidoyl Chloride

Various primary and secondary alcohols were smoothly oxidized to the corresponding aldehydes and ketones by using a new oxidizing agent, N-t-butylbenzenesulfinimidoyl chloride (4a), in the coexistence of DBU or zinc oxide. The present oxidation proceeded under mild conditions via five-membered intramolecular proton-transfer of an alkyl arenesulfinimidate intermediate.
